Tree Removal Cost - The typical cost for removing a small to medium-sized tree ranges from $200 to $700, depending on the tree's size and location. Larger trees or those in hard-to-reach areas can cost $1,000 or more. Local pros can provide estimates based on specific project details.
Stump Grinding Expenses - Stump grinding services usually cost between $100 and $300 per stump. The price varies with stump size, depth, and accessibility. Some projects may incur additional charges for grinding multiple stumps or extensive root systems.
Additional Service Fees - Extra services such as hauling away debris or pruning branches can add $50 to $200 to the overall cost. These fees depend on the scope of work and the amount of material to be removed.
Cost Factors - Factors influencing costs include tree height, species, location, and the complexity of the removal. Local service providers can offer detailed quotes tailored to specific trees and site conditions.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
